Biographical / Historical

Jean Currie trained as an occupational therapist and took a course at Astley-Ainslie Hospital in and around 1942. She worked as a nurse at Bangour Village Hospital, a psychiatric hospital, shortly before the Second World War and during the war, when the hospital was converted into Edinburgh War Hospital. She continued to work at the hospital after the war, when it reverted back to its function as a psychiatric hospital.
